WebHand sanitizers usually contain alcohols that have been FDA approved for topical use. These can be hazardous in larger quantities, but a taste amount usually does not cause serious symptoms. Even so, check here to make sure it is not a product contaminated with methanol. Methanol will not be listed on the label.
